Fear Poem by Tony Adah

Fear



For Fear of monkeys
I will never plant my corn
In my own house
I will never detest trouble
And have my knees behind my legs
Like a hen.
I will fight on
Persevere bravely
Into the kingdom of warriors.
If I worship you, fear
I will be expecting
The snail soon
To pick his feet
Put them onto its torso
And run away.
